Mitsubishi Electric MES3-EAP1-DA, MES3-EAP1-AI Specification

The Mitsubishi Electric MES3-EAP1-DA and MES3-EAP1-AI are advanced modules designed for integration with Mitsubishi's MELSEC iQ-R and iQ-F series automation platforms. These modules are engineered to enhance process control and data acquisition capabilities within industrial environments. The MES3-EAP1-DA is a digital-to-analog converter module, providing precision conversion of digital signals into analog outputs. It supports a variety of output ranges, ensuring compatibility with diverse industrial equipment and sensor requirements. High-resolution output and robust noise immunity make it suitable for critical control applications.

Meanwhile, the MES3-EAP1-AI is an analog input module that facilitates the acquisition of high-fidelity analog signals from various industrial sensors. It is equipped with multiple input channels, allowing concurrent monitoring of numerous parameters. This module boasts high sampling rates and superior accuracy, ensuring that even subtle variations in process conditions are captured and processed efficiently. Mitsubishi Electric MES3-EAP1-DA, MES3-EAP1-AI F.A.Q.

What is the purpose of the MES3-EAP1-DA module in a Mitsubishi Electric system?

The MES3-EAP1-DA module is used for digital-to-analog conversion in Mitsubishi Electric systems. It allows digital signals to be converted to analog signals, enabling the control of analog devices.

How can you troubleshoot communication errors with the MES3-EAP1-AI module?

To troubleshoot communication errors with the MES3-EAP1-AI module, check the wiring connections, ensure correct configuration settings in the PLC, and verify that the module firmware is up to date.

How can you verify the correct operation of an MES3-EAP1-AI module after installation?

To verify the correct operation of an MES3-EAP1-AI module, perform a functional test by applying known input signals and confirming that the module outputs the expected data. Check the PLC readings to ensure they match the input values.
